Achieving peak performance in commercial real estate involves a multifaceted strategy.

First and foremost, it's crucial to execute thorough market research to understand the current conditions within your target sector. This allows informed actions regarding rental rates, tenant acquisition, and property upgrades.

A well-defined advertising plan can significantly draw potential tenants. Showcasing the property's unique benefits and its central location is paramount to generating interest.

Moreover, maintaining a high level of building maintenance is essential for tenant contentment and long-term value appreciation. Regular audits can uncover potential concerns before they deteriorate, thus minimizing costs.

Effective dialog with tenants is also essential for cultivating strong ties. Addressing to their requests promptly and efficiently can enhance tenant commitment.

Sustainable Practices in Commercial Real Estate Operations

The building sector industry is increasingly adopting sustainable practices to minimize its burden. This shift is driven by a growing awareness among stakeholders, including investors, tenants, and regulators. Adopting green building standards, such as LEED certification, has become a prominent benchmark for assessing the greenness of commercial properties.

  • Energy optimization measures, such as efficient lighting systems, play a crucial role in lowering utility bills.
  • Water preservation strategies, including greywater recycling, help to conserve water resources.
  • Encouraging sustainable transportation options, such as bike infrastructure and electric vehicle infrastructure, can minimize greenhouse gas emissions.

By prioritizing these sustainable practices, the commercial real estate industry can create healthier, more environmentally responsible buildings that address the challenges of climate change.
